HR Operations Manager
The Role:
BnM is currently looking for a motivated and experienced HR Operations Manager to join our Enabling Services team in Newbridge. The successful candidate will lead the delivery of efficient, consistent, compliant, and best-in-class HR operational services across BnM, supporting the organisation's continued growth as a leading renewable energy company. The role is responsible for driving service excellence through the continuous enhancement of HR processes, policies,employee lifecycle administration, HR systems, data integrity, and service standards. It ensures that managers and employees receive a professional, responsive, customer-focused, and highquality HR service, while championing continuous improvement and operational effectiveness across the HR function.
The main duties and responsibilities of the role will include the following:
- Lead the day-to-day delivery of HR operational services, ensuring efficient administration across the employee lifecycle including onboarding, contractual changes, probation, absence, leave, employee records, offboarding and related HR processes. Partner with colleagues on payroll, pensions, compensation and benefits to ensure seamless employee lifecycle administration and a consistent employee experience.
- Develop, document, standardise and continuously improve HR processes, workflows and service standards, ensuring clear ownership, effective controls, appropriate approvals and a consistent employee and manager experience. HR lead for the Joiner, Mover, Leaver process, employee onboarding and induction processes working closely with the wider HR team. Identify opportunities to simplify, automate and improve HR operations, reducing manual effort and enabling the HR team to focus on higher-value advisory, strategic and people-focused activity.
- Manage the end to end talent acquisition process. Continuously review and improve the talent acquisition process to ensure the efficient attraction of talent and capabilities to the business.
- Design and implement best in class people policies, practices and procedures ensuring compliance with legislative requirements. Lead the BI Reporting for HR providing a suite of KPIs and people metrics to monitor business performance including but not limited to data quality, process cycle times, absence, headcount changes, recruitment approvals, employee lifecycle activity and policy compliance trends.
- Act as the HR lead for operational use of HR systems, ensuring employee data is accurate, secure and maintained in line with data protection requirements. Support system improvements, automation, self-service, reporting and adoption of digital HR ways of working.Lead the implementation of a new HRIS.
- Partner with HR Business Partners and key stakeholders to support the successful delivery of strategic people initiatives, projects, events, communications, and change programmes. Lead or contribute to HR and cross-functional projects, continuous improvement initiatives, employee engagement activities, and ad hoc business priorities as required, ensuring high-quality execution and alignment with organisational and people strategy objectives.

What we're looking for:The ideal candidate will possess the following qualification, skills, knowledge, and attributes:
- Hons Degree in a Business or HR related discipline is essential. 5 years + experience of working in a human centric strategic HR team leading the HR Operations function.
- Highly developed analytical and problem-solving skills with capacity to implement and operationalise people systems and processes. Advanced communication skills, with the ability to effectively influence, partner and challenge individuals at all levels of the business. Ability to multi-task, displaying skill in establishing priorities and managing workloads to meet challenging deadlines. Resilient and capable of dealing with pressurised situations and deadlines.
- Build and maintain strong relationships with internal and external stakeholders. Strong people leadership capabilities being able to build and develop a high performing team and manage success through others. Excellent report writing and communication skills, with proficiency in Microsoft Office applications including Word, Excel and PowerPoint.
- Experience of implementing and operationalising HR & Payroll systems in preferable. CIPD accreditation desirable
